Donkey Burger

Donkey Burger (Chinese: 驴肉火烧; pinyin: lǘròu huǒshāo) is a kind of sandwich commonly eaten in Baoding and Hejian, Hebei Province, China, where it is considered a local specialty, as well as in other places in China. Chopped or shredded donkey meat is placed within a huǒshāo or shao bing, a roasted, semi-flaky bread pocket, and eaten as a snack or as part of a meal. The meat is often served cold, often with green pepper or cilantro leaves, in a warm huoshao. Donkey burgers have two styles, Baoding style and Hejian style. Baoding style use round huoshao, Hejian style use rectangle huoshao.
